Checking levels
If a level drops significantly, have the corresponding system checked by a PEUGEOT dealer or a qualified workshop. Check all of these levels regularly and top them up if necessary, unless otherwise indicated.
Take care when working under the bonnet, as certain areas of the engine may be extremely hot (risk of burns).
